summaryrefslogtreecommitdiffstats
path: root/Tools
diff options
context:
space:
mode:
authorGuido van Rossum <guido@python.org>2024-02-29 00:05:53 (GMT)
committerGitHub <noreply@github.com>2024-02-29 00:05:53 (GMT)
commit86e5e063aba76a7f4fc58f7d06b17b0a4730fd8e (patch)
treec05481118366a7abea7bb2531b861ab3d7712622 /Tools
parent479ac5ce8a311c9a5830b96e972478867fcbce61 (diff)
downloadcpython-86e5e063aba76a7f4fc58f7d06b17b0a4730fd8e.zip
cpython-86e5e063aba76a7f4fc58f7d06b17b0a4730fd8e.tar.gz
cpython-86e5e063aba76a7f4fc58f7d06b17b0a4730fd8e.tar.bz2
gh-115816: Generate calls to sym_new_const() etc. without _Py_uop prefix (#116077)
This was left behind by GH-115987. Basically a lot of diffs like this: ``` - res = _Py_uop_sym_new_unknown(ctx); + res = sym_new_unknown(ctx); ```
Diffstat (limited to 'Tools')
-rw-r--r--Tools/cases_generator/optimizer_generator.py8
1 files changed, 4 insertions, 4 deletions
diff --git a/Tools/cases_generator/optimizer_generator.py b/Tools/cases_generator/optimizer_generator.py
index e933fee..d3ce4c8 100644
--- a/Tools/cases_generator/optimizer_generator.py
+++ b/Tools/cases_generator/optimizer_generator.py
@@ -28,7 +28,7 @@ from generators_common import (
from cwriter import CWriter
from typing import TextIO, Iterator
from lexer import Token
-from stack import StackOffset, Stack, SizeMismatch, UNUSED
+from stack import Stack, SizeMismatch, UNUSED
DEFAULT_OUTPUT = ROOT / "Python/optimizer_cases.c.h"
DEFAULT_ABSTRACT_INPUT = ROOT / "Python/optimizer_bytecodes.c"
@@ -87,14 +87,14 @@ def emit_default(out: CWriter, uop: Uop) -> None:
if var.name != "unused" and not var.peek:
if var.is_array():
out.emit(f"for (int _i = {var.size}; --_i >= 0;) {{\n")
- out.emit(f"{var.name}[_i] = _Py_uop_sym_new_unknown(ctx);\n")
+ out.emit(f"{var.name}[_i] = sym_new_unknown(ctx);\n")
out.emit(f"if ({var.name}[_i] == NULL) goto out_of_space;\n")
out.emit("}\n")
elif var.name == "null":
- out.emit(f"{var.name} = _Py_uop_sym_new_null(ctx);\n")
+ out.emit(f"{var.name} = sym_new_null(ctx);\n")
out.emit(f"if ({var.name} == NULL) goto out_of_space;\n")
else:
- out.emit(f"{var.name} = _Py_uop_sym_new_unknown(ctx);\n")
+ out.emit(f"{var.name} = sym_new_unknown(ctx);\n")
out.emit(f"if ({var.name} == NULL) goto out_of_space;\n")